Material and Build
The mesh upper material provides a lightweight alternative to traditional leather work boots while maintaining sufficient durability for industrial use. This construction reduces overall shoe weight, which can decrease leg fatigue during long shifts in machinery operation or chemical processing environments. The steel toe component meets standard impact resistance requirements for industrial footwear, with specific design elements addressing both anti-smash and anti-puncture protection needs. The low-top design offers greater ankle mobility than traditional work boots, which can be advantageous in settings where frequent bending or squatting positions are required during work tasks.

Event or Professional Use
In machinery operation environments, the steel toe protection guards against impact injuries from falling tools, equipment components, or moving machinery parts. The anti-smash construction specifically addresses compression hazards common around heavy industrial equipment where feet might be positioned near moving parts or under suspended loads. For chemical industry applications, the anti-puncture feature provides protection against sharp debris, broken glass, or metal fragments that might be present on processing facility floors. The lightweight construction reduces fatigue during long shifts monitoring chemical processes or operating industrial machinery.
